Dogecoin, the beloved cryptocurrency inspired by the popular Doge meme, has captured the hearts and minds of countless enthusiasts around the world. Its unique combination of humor, community spirit, and potential value has made it a true phenomenon in the digital asset space.
The origins of Dogecoin can be traced back to 2013, when software engineers Billy Markus and Jackson Palmer created it as a parody of the countless altcoins that were emerging at the time. Little did they know that their playful creation would become one of the most iconic cryptocurrencies in history.
Dogecoin's success can be attributed to several key factors. Firstly, its mascot, the Shiba Inu dog, is instantly recognizable and has become synonymous with the cryptocurrency. The use of memes and humor in its marketing and community engagement has also resonated with people, creating a strong sense of belonging.
Moreover, the technical underpinnings of Dogecoin are solid. It is based on the Litecoin blockchain, which provides a secure and reliable foundation. Dogecoin transactions are fast and inexpensive, making it a viable option for everyday use.
The Dogecoin community is one of its defining strengths. It is a vibrant and passionate group of individuals who are dedicated to promoting the cryptocurrency and supporting its growth. The community has organized numerous charity initiatives and outreach programs, demonstrating the positive impact that Dogecoin can have.
Of course, the value of Dogecoin has also been a major factor in its popularity. While it started out as a joke currency, it has since gained significant value, particularly in 2021 when it surged to an all-time high of $0.74. While its value has since fluctuated, it remains a top-20 cryptocurrency by market capitalization.
However, the success of Dogecoin has not come without its challenges. The cryptocurrency has faced criticism for its lack of a clear use case beyond being a speculative asset. It has also been plagued by volatility and pump-and-dump schemes, which have raised concerns among some investors.
